When one exchanges steel rims with custom rims, what are the steps to keep the tire sensing units intact. Thanks again.

The TPMS unit is held to the wheel with an aluminum nut on the outside of the wheel. You just need to loosen the nut and take the sensor out of the wheel. Installation is reverse of the removal. Torque the nut to 8 Nm. (double check the service manual)
it wont work. with aftermarket rims the valve stem hole is bigger then the senors. so you would need to buy some from a tire web site. thats what i had to do
